Output 755a403d96de2c17a548fa432c2f4b37692778e0aed3b59a247f19761b62c973:1

value
1046320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59cd818b45df3015f29757b4c569360831590c34 OP_EQUAL
address
39srFRfUPVuvkS4igQCUUGESXPCbiYSrVh
transaction
755a403d96de2c17a548fa432c2f4b37692778e0aed3b59a247f19761b62c973
confirmations
296858
spent
true